Pan and I had never planned to get engaged. We planned to get married right away, and wanted to do a small merisik (pre-engagement involving two families only). But my parents insisted on engagement ceremony – because that’s a tradition of Melaka people and because I’m the first daughter and granddaughter.

So, my parents set the engagement date to be on Dec 28, 2019 and this date has been set like 5 months ago. Pan and I started to think of what to give each other for the hatarans (gifts) and we decided on 5-7 of dulangs – I’ll give him 7 gifts and he’ll give me 5. Women need to give more gifts because men’s gifts are known to be more expensive. Do you wanna know what were our hantarans? Keep reading.

Over the 5 months of planning, I didn’t plan for the event to be big. It should be like less than 50 family members from both sides, the hantarans, food and that’s all. It got escalated to be a three-tent ceremony, with 300 invitees, food caterers, multiple types of desserts, dress, mini dais, hand bouquet, photographer, makeup artist like omg.
